Jack Reacher’s cover finally gets blown inReacherseason 3’s episode 6. However, before Quinn and his men can do anything to him, he hops inside a vehicle and drives through the massive gates of Zachary Beck’s mansion. In season 3’s episode 6, Reacher smashing the gates open shows how he, too, understands when he should flee the scene instead of standing his ground and sticking around to fight. At the same time,the gates also seem to foreshadow how Richard Beck will eventually escape his father’s mansion.

After everything he has been through, it is hard not to foresee how Richard will eventually grow frustrated and drive out of the mansion’s broken gates.

Jack Reacher (Alan Ritchson) is teaching Richard Beck (Johnny Berchtold) how to box in Reacher Season 3 Ep 4

Zachary Beck’s son, Richard, has been the punching bag for villains like Quinn, who want to establish control over Beck’s gun-running business. He is his father’s kryptonite, allowing Quinn to control his father by torturing him. If it wasn’t for his father’s shady business, Richard could have had a better life. Unfortunately, even though he is not involved in his father’s unethical activities in any capacity, Quinn targets him to gain control over his father. Quinn even cut off his ear to make Zachary his puppet.

Reacher has been more of a father figure for Richard than Zachary. While Zachary Beck remains too invested in his business and rarely checks up on his son, Reacher dedicates time to teaching him self-defense and thrashes his bullies to protect him. The fact that Richard does not tell his father the truth about Reacher’s undercover mission even after learning that he is working with the DEA shows that he, too, appreciates having him around. Owing to this, it seems likeReacher’s action of breaking the gates serves somewhat as a sign for Richard to follow his leadand free himself from his toxic father.

Reacher follows Jack Reacher, a former military police investigator, as he navigates civilian life. Without a phone and carrying minimal belongings, Reacher drifts across the country, experiencing the nation he once served, and encounters intriguing challenges along the way.
